    In this emotional and eye-opening episode, Grace is joined by Maddie to discuss the harsh realities of being trapped in an abusive relationship. Maddie bravely shares her personal story of enduring physical, verbal, and emotional abuse at the age of 24. She reflects on the challenges of recognizing the abuse and the courage it took to seek help and ultimately escape the toxic relationship. Together, Grace and Maddie explore the warning signs, the emotional toll, and the importance of reaching out for support before it's too late.

    Resources for Men and Women Experiencing Abuse:

    National Domestic Violence Hotline: thehotline.org – 24/7 confidential support for anyone facing abuse. Call 1-800-799-SAFE (7233).
    Love Is Respect: loveisrespect.org – Support for young people in abusive relationships.
    1in6: 1in6.org – Resources specifically for men who have experienced sexual or emotional abuse.
    RAINN: RAINN.org – Support for survivors of sexual violence. Call the National Sexual Assault Hotline at 1-800-656-HOPE (4673).

    In this powerful episode, Kyle shares his personal story of sexual assault, diving deep into the trauma, isolation, and fear that many men face when trying to speak up. We explore the harsh societal stigmas that prevent men from reporting abuse and seeking help, and how this silence can have lasting emotional and psychological impacts. Kyle's journey of resilience is one many need to hear, as it sheds light on the often overlooked reality that men experience sexual assault too.

    If you or someone you love are being abused, The Sexual Assault Hotline from RAINN is 1-800-656-4673

    Please contact them if you are in need of help, the hotline is open to call or text 24/7.
    The Domestic Abuse Hotline can be accessed via the nationwide number 1−800−799−SAFE(7233) or TTY 1−800−787−3224 or (206) 518-9361 (Video Phone Only for Deaf Callers). The Hotline provides service referrals to agencies in all 50 states, Puerto Rico, Guam and the U.S. Virgin Islands. Persons can also contact the Hotline through an email request from the
    Hotline website.
